Description:
Located just right of THE HARD WAY in the middle of the cliff band. Follow 2 bolts past thin face and through the imposing and unlikely roof (bolt) heading out right to a left trending diagonal hand crack. Follow the crack (small hands, fingers) back left and up to ring anchors. Strong fingers! Unlike its neighbor THE HARD WAY, this one was cleaned and bolted The Easy Way - on rappel. Tough Schist listed as 5.11a.
